"Is this worth your time? If you have a soft spot for 1930s adventure films and want to see Paul Robeson command a screen, sure. But if you need a tight script or a story that makes sense all the way to the end, maybe skip it. It feels like someone took a bunch of desert footage and tried to staple a plot onto it while running out of glue. The whole thing starts with a firing squad. That part is actually pretty tense. Then, suddenly, we’re in Arabia and the movie just sort of forgets to keep the..."
